Just thought, perhaps, I might post a few of the local adoptables!

Yaro, stray, front declawed, female orange DLH - Hugs!!



Lonesome, stray, front declawed/neutered, male DLH grey & white tuxie - Snuggler!



Sahara, surrender, front declawed/neutered- spraying, massive UTI!


Mojave, surrender, front declawed/neutered- spraying, massive UTI! Very overweight!



Norm, surrender, front declawed/neutered, mitted tabby - not thrilled with a bear hug by me!
Loves everyone(wanted to go see someone else in the pics)



Lolly, surrender, front declawed/spayed - shy!


Binx, surrender - silly!


Boots, surrender - lap cat!


Binx & Boots need to be placed together. Sahara & Mojave came in together, but will likely be seperated. Lolly & Norm came in together, but will likely be seperated.

We have had 3 stray front declawed kitties in the past month(2 in the past week). And 4 front declawed surrenders in the past month. One more came in today.

My goodness, what is wrong with people? I love Lonesome and Captain. Obviously, I am way too far away, but I do have a question. Can declawed cats be safely placed with "regular" cats, or does the fact that they have no "defense system" make it unsafe?

My Twitch is front declawed, all my other have claws....they all do fine. Twitch actually has no teeth, no claws, & is deaf. When she attacks, even the 90 lb dog ducks!
